Entanglement entropy of integer Quantum Hall states in polygonal domains
The entanglement entropy of the integer Quantum Hall states satisfies the
area law for smooth domains with a vanishing topological term. In this paper we
consider polygonal domains for which the area law acquires a constant term that
only depends on the angles of the vertices and we give a general expression for
it. We study also the dependence of the entanglement spectrum on the geometry
